if 9 more than twice a number is 3 less than three times the same number, what is the number?
Answer:
the number is 12
Step-by-step explanation:
9+2x=3x-3
9+3=3x-2x
12=x
The required number is 12.
What are linear equation?A linear equation only has one or two variables. No variables in a linear equation is raised to power greater than 1 or used as denominator of a fraction.
Now it is given that,9 more than twice a number is 3 less than three times the same number.
Let the number be x.
So, 9 more than twice a number = 9 +2x
and, 3 less than three times the same number = 3x - 3
Hence we have,
9 + 2x = 3x - 3
Adding 3 both the side we get,
12 + 2x = 3x
Now substracting 2x both the side we get,
x = 12
Hence the number is 12.

Alex is motorboat took four hours to make a trip down stream with a 5 mph current. The return trip against the same current took six hours. Find the speed of the boat in Stillwater and the distance he traveled.
Answer:
25 mph
120 miles
Step-by-step explanation:
We have that the speed is equal to:
v = d / t
if we solve for distance:
d = v * t
in this case, since it is the same route both outward and back, the distances are equal, therefore:
v1 * t1 = v2 * t2
t1 = 4 hours
t2 = 6 hours
v1 = x + 5 (downstream speed)
v2 = x -5 (upstream speed)
replacing:
(x + 5) * 4 = (x - 5) * 6
4 * x + 20 = 6 * x - 30
6 * x - 4 * x = 20 + 30
2 * x = 50
x = 25
speed is 25 mph
now the distance would be:
d = (25 + 5) * 4 = 120
d = (25 - 5) * 6 = 120
In other words, the route was 120 miles.
